In Limpopo, a political storm is brewing around the province’s most prominent figure, Premier Dr. Phophi Ramathuba. Known for her blunt, no-nonsense approach and a reputation for getting things done, her leadership style is now at the center of a fierce internal debate. The critical question being asked in ANC circles is whether her decisive action is what the province needs, or if it is systematically undermining the party’s fragile unity.
Ramathuba, who rose to national prominence for her unflinching public statements on healthcare and immigration, has carried that same directness into the premier’s office. She projects an image of a leader impatient with bureaucracy and focused on tangible results. But this very approach, praised by some, is now being cited by party insiders as a source of deepening internal rifts.
A Clash of Styles: Decisiveness vs. Consultation
The core of the criticism from within the ANC is that the premier’s centralized, action-oriented style bypasses traditional party structures. In a organization built on collective consultation and branch-level consensus, her tendency to drive projects forward without what some call “sufficient engagement” is seen as a breach of political protocol.
Detractors argue that this alienates the very party veterans and regional structures that form the backbone of the ANC in the province. They fear that a “one-woman show” erodes the collective spirit and could have devastating consequences for the party’s cohesion ahead of crucial future elections.
The Defence: A Leader for the People, Not the Politicians
For her supporters, however, this criticism is the predictable grumbling of a stale political establishment being shaken up. They argue that Ramathuba’s focus on delivery and her willingness to cut through red tape is exactly what Limpopo needs after years of service delivery backlogs.
From this perspective, the complaints about her style are merely the sound of patronage networks being disrupted and officials being held accountable. Her supporters contend that her popularity with citizens who are tired of empty promises is more valuable than her popularity in closed-door party meetings.
The Stakes for the ANC’s Heartland
Limpopo is a crucial heartland for the ANC. A full-blown internal fracture here would be catastrophic for the national party. The debate over Ramathuba’s leadership is therefore a proxy for a larger battle over the soul of the ANC: should it prioritize internal political maintenance, or does its survival depend on visible, rapid delivery that wins back public trust?
The outcome of this internal tension will define not only Ramathuba’s future but the political trajectory of the province itself. Is she the strong leader Limpopo has been waiting for, or is her method of governance inadvertently weakening the very party that put her in power? The answer will determine the fate of the ANC in one of its most important strongholds.
